Molecular Orbital Calculation with Local Structure Model
Shi-aki Hyodo

The local structure model, for the molecular orbital calculation of systems including a large number of atoms, was rationalized on the basis of well-established chemical concepts, especially the functional group and the localization of orbital in chemical reactions. By modeling with the previously established chemical concepts and selecting parameters suitable to the given problem, the molecular orbital calculation with a local structure model was found to be a useful approach to the electronic-state-based character of large systems.
